PCI: endpoint: Retain fixed-size BAR size as well as aligned size
[ Upstream commit 793908d60b8745c386b9f4e29eb702f74ceb0886 ] When allocating space for an endpoint function on a BAR with a fixed size, the size saved in 'struct pci_epf_bar.size' should be the fixed size as expected by pci_epc_set_bar(). However, if pci_epf_alloc_space() increased the allocation size to accommodate iATU alignment requirements, it previously saved the larger aligned size in .size, which broke pci_epc_set_bar(). To solve this, keep the fixed BAR size in .size and save the aligned size in a new .aligned_size for use when deallocating it. diff --git a/include/linux/pci-epf.h b/include/linux/pci-epf.h
index 18a3aeb62ae4..cd6f8f4bc454 100644
--- a/include/linux/pci-epf.h
+++ b/include/linux/pci-epf.h
@@ -114,6 +114,8 @@ struct pci_epf_driver {
* @phys_addr: physical address that should be mapped to the BAR
* @addr: virtual address corresponding to the @phys_addr
* @size: the size of the address space present in BAR
+ * @aligned_size: the size actually allocated to accommodate the iATU alignment
+ * requirement
* @barno: BAR number
* @flags: flags that are set for the BAR
*/
@@ -121,6 +123,7 @@ struct pci_epf_bar {
dma_addr_t phys_addr;
void *addr;
size_t size;
+ size_t aligned_size;
enum pci_barno barno;
int flags;
};
